Garmin Express doesn't connect and doesn't recognize the Tactix Bravo after upgrade software to version 7.5 !!

Please read this :
https://forums.garmin.com/showthread.php?358617-Fenix-3-Tactix-Bravo-Quatix-3-7-51-Beta-Release&p=890258#post890258
The best workaround is to find the CIQ app with international char. (for his name) and delete (uninstall) it from your smartphone (GCM)

Tactix and Garmin Express - Application "Tides"
Hi...
Answer from Garmin
: The problem is a bug in the "
Tides
" Application. Remove "Tides" and
Garmin Express
connect again.
